JLL | Global Transaction Management & REPM

Position Overview

JLL is seeking a Transaction Management and Strategy Senior Analyst to support our dedicated account team. This role is central to account governance, reporting, and strategic real estate planning across North America and globally. The ideal candidate will bring analytical rigor, strong client relationship skills, and a proactive approach to process improvement and automation.

Role Responsibilities
  • Prepare and track data within client-facing reports, presentations, analyses, BI galleries, and Performance Scorecards
  • Manage the Transaction Management Project Tracking tool and associated data tracking programs to ensure data integrity
  • Forecast, track, and reconcile transaction status, commission revenue, balancing payment status, and savings data in web-based applications
  • Support the Global TM Lead on year-end reporting, NA TM Meetings, QBRs, MBRs, and ad hoc requests
  • Collaborate with client and JLL finance teams to assist with commission and balancing payment forecasting and year-end reconciliations
  • Prepare commission invoices and client invoices for all North America transactions
  • Oversee annual Mark to Market global updates, reviews, and presentations
  • Update and manage CBAs and process documents in SharePoint and client audit
  • (Potential to) Co-lead small transactions with limited oversight
  • Work directly with clients, brokers, and team members to resolve financial, transaction, strategy, and landlord challenges
  • Support and/or lead global meetings and training initiatives
  • Actively contribute to process, reporting, and governance improvement opportunities including automation

About Jones Lang LaSalle Incorporated

Jones Lang LaSalle is a financial and professional services firm that specializes in commercial real estate services and investment management. Its services include: tenant representation for organizations that lease office, industrial and retail spaces; consulting, which supports companies to develop workplace strategies such as occupancy planning, relocations, and energy and environmental sustainability initiatives; project and development services to manage ground-up creation, building construction, and major interior renovations; capital markets and real estate investment banking, which helps organizations buy and sell properties, and improve the financial impact of their real estate; facilities management for a variety of properties including office towers, retail and exhibition centers, and government, collegiate and industrial complexes; property management services, that provide on-site administration to help owners of office, industrial, retail and specialty properties reduce costs and enhance their property values; and valuations that provide impartial assessments of real estate worth through more than 200 corporate offices in 70 countries. Jones Lang LaSalle was formed by the merger of Jones Lang Wootton, a British firm with origins dating back to 1783, and LaSalle Partners, an American company formed from a predecessor launched in 1968. Jones Lang Wootton opened its first US office in New York in 1975. In 1997, the initial public offering was completed by LaSalle Partners for the company's common stock in the market.
